"processed": "\n <p>Although I wouldn't consider myself a \"Laravel Developer\", I enjoy watching the talks from the Laravel conferences, most recently Laracon US, that took place last week.<\/p>\n\n<p>I like to learn from other communities and adopt relevant practices or tools within my projects. I did this with Laravel Collections, which I use on nearly every project.<\/p>\n\n<h2 id=\"laravel-prompts\">Laravel Prompts<\/h2>\n\n<p>I watched Jess Archer's talk on the new Laravel Prompts and was happy when she said it worked with plain PHP projects, not just Laravel.<\/p>\n\n<p>This means I can potentially use it with Drupal and Drush or Symfony Console applications, too, such as my build configuration file generator.<\/p>\n\n<h2 id=\"here%27s-the-thing\">Here's the thing<\/h2>\n\n<p>I like tools I can use across multiple technologies and prefer framework-agnostic tools to specific ones.<\/p>\n\n<p>Then, if I'm working on a different project, I can use the tools I already know instead of learning something different just for that.<\/p>\n\n ",
